George Kyriacos Panayiotou was a fat little kid with glasses who played the violin and dreamed of becoming a pilot. But when he was twelve he met a wild schoolboy rascal named Andrew Ridgeley and Wham! - the dream changed.
The rest is pop history.
And it's all here - from the lonely childhood to the early struggles, the one-night stands, the first album, the first flash of fame, the worldwide superstardom with "Wake Me Up Before You Go-Go", Live Aid, the history-making China tour, the tearful, triumphant frenzy of the final Wham! concert before 72,000 screaming fans, and his chart-busting blast-off as a solo superstar. His life is a jam-packed story of music, mania ans money - of relationships with Elton John, Simon Le Bon, Brooky Shields, and Kathy Sueng - of love, loneliness and laughter on the way to the top of the world.
